Pearled Barley Pilaf

A fiber-rich pearled barley pilaf is prepared with sautéed onions and garlic, finished with fresh parsley and lemon zest.

Instructions

  1. Warm o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

  2. Add chopped onions and garlic; cook, stirring, for 5 to 7 minutes until soft.

  3. Stir in pearled barley and toast for 3 minutes.

  4. Bring water to a boil in a separate saucepan. Transfer the barley mixture to the saucepan, then stir in salt and pepper.

  5.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 45 minutes until the barley is tender.

  6. Remove from heat, keep covered for 5 minutes, then uncover and cool for 5 minutes.

  7. Stir in parsley, lemon zest, and adjust seasoning to taste.
